Bingo is a captivating game of chance where players mark off numbers or symbols on cards as they are called out, with the goal of completing a specific pattern to win. This game merges simplicity with excitement, offering various adaptations to suit any gathering or educational purpose.
This classic version of Bingo uses a grid of numbers, traditionally arranged in a 5x5 matrix under the letters B-I-N-G-O. Each column of the grid corresponds to one letter and contains a specific range of numbers. Traditional Bingo is a staple at social gatherings and community halls, where the communal atmosphere amplifies the excitement as players eagerly await the next number.
Themed Bingo allows for a customized experience, where the usual numbers on the bingo cards are replaced with words, phrases, or images that align with a particular theme. This variant is popular at holiday events, school settings, and special occasions. For instance, a Christmas-themed Bingo might feature words like "Santa," "Reindeer," or "Sleigh," while an educational Bingo game could use vocabulary words from a current lesson, enhancing learning through play.
Ideal for young children or games that aim to be more visually engaging, Picture Bingo replaces numbers with images. This type can be particularly useful in educational settings or in therapeutic environments, helping players (especially young learners or non-native language speakers) to associate images with words and concepts without the need for literacy skills. Picture Bingo can also be themed around specific learning topics, such as animals, objects in nature, or everyday items, making it a versatile tool for instruction and fun.

Hosting a Bingo game can be a fun and engaging activity for all ages, whether it’s for a family gathering, a school event, or just a casual evening with friends. To make your game a success, it's important to organize it well and keep the excitement alive. Here are some key tips to help you ensure your Bingo game runs smoothly and everyone has a great time.
To maintain a competitive edge, it's crucial that each player has a unique Bingo card. Different combinations on each card will ensure that no two games are the same, keeping the gameplay exciting and fair for everyone involved.
Before the game begins, clearly explain the winning patterns to all players. Whether it’s completing a row, a column, a diagonal, or a special pattern like a square or an X, knowing these details upfront will help players understand what to aim for and how to strategize.
Enhance the enjoyment of the game by using fun and thematic markers. Depending on the occasion, you can use anything from candies and colored chips to themed stickers. This not only adds a layer of fun but also helps to visually distinguish the games.
Motivate players and add excitement to the game by offering small prizes for the winners. Prizes can be simple yet appealing, like small toys, gift cards, or novelty items that align with the theme of the game. Having a tangible reward can increase participation and enthusiasm among players.
